I had a bladder problem, where my urine was not coming out. I went to a doctor and I got myself checked and the problem went away. But after that I have been thinking about peeing all the time, the experience left a huge impact on me. And whenever I think about peeing, I get this sensations which are very annoying and it's become really hard for me to concentrate and do anything properly. It's all in my head, how do I stop thinking about it? I tried diverting my mind and doing all the things that one can. I would love to hear what can I do?

There can be anxiety related with peeing, a short course of anxiolytics with behavioral modification methods will help you recover. Consult any psychiatrist in person or online for the same. Good luck.
